Immobility
A state or condition in which a person or entity is unable to move or be moved, often leading to potential health risks or complications.
Lateral Position
A body position where the patient lies on their side, often used for medical examination, treatment, or to promote patient comfort.
Torticollis
A condition characterized by an abnormal, asymmetrical head or neck position, often due to muscle contraction, congenital abnormalities, or other causes.
Sternocleidomastoid Muscle
A muscle in the side of the neck that acts to flex and rotate the head.
